When selecting DEWALT power tools for woodworking, consider several factors to ensure you choose the right equipment for your projects. First, power and performance are crucial; tools with brushless motors tend to offer longer runtime and greater efficiency. Next, size and weight influence maneuverability, especially when working in tight or awkward spaces common in woodworking.
Another important aspect is versatility. A combo kit with both drill and impact driver can significantly streamline your workflow, allowing you to handle a variety of tasks without switching tools. Battery capacity and runtime are also vital—more Ah (amp-hours) mean longer work sessions without frequent recharging. Lastly, features like LED work lights, ergonomic grips, and quick-release chucks enhance usability and comfort, reducing fatigue during extended projects.
In terms of value, balance performance with cost. While high-end models offer advanced features, they should align with your specific needs to avoid overspending. For casual DIYers, lightweight and simpler models may suffice, whereas professionals require more robust and durable options. Carefully evaluate your typical projects and choose tools that can grow with your skills.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the key difference between brushed and brushless motors?
Brushless motors are more efficient, produce less heat, and typically offer longer runtime and increased durability compared to brushed motors.
Is a combo kit worth the extra cost?
Yes, especially if you need both drill and impact driver functionality. It saves money and provides a complete solution for versatile woodworking tasks.
How important is battery capacity for woodworking?
Higher Ah batteries provide longer run time, which is beneficial for extended woodworking projects, reducing downtime for recharging.
Can I use these tools for masonry or heavy-duty work?
No, these drills are designed for woodworking and light applications. For masonry or industrial tasks, specialized tools are recommended.
